PropertyShark features and specs

  • Comprehensive Data
    PropertyShark offers extensive property details, including ownership, zoning, sales history, and property value estimates, making it a valuable resource for real estate professionals and investors.
  • Interactive Maps
    The platform provides interactive maps that allow users to visualize data like zoning, comparables, and neighborhood stats, which can aid in making informed decisions.
  • Variety of Search Filters
    With numerous search filters available, users can easily narrow down properties based on criteria such as location, lot size, building square footage, and more.
  • Access to Public Records
    Users can access a wealth of public records, including mortgage documents, property deeds, and permits, all in one place without visiting multiple local government websites.
  • Foreclosure and Pre-Foreclosure Information
    The site provides detailed data on foreclosures and pre-foreclosures, which is crucial for investors looking for distressed property opportunities.

Possible disadvantages of PropertyShark

  • Subscription Cost
    Access to full features and detailed reports on PropertyShark requires a subscription, which can be costly, especially for casual users or small businesses.
  • Complex Interface
    The platform can be overwhelming for new users due to its complex interface and abundance of data options, requiring a learning curve to utilize effectively.
  • Geographic Limitation
    PropertyShark primarily covers properties in the United States, which may limit its usefulness for those interested in properties in other countries.
  • Data Timeliness
    Some users have reported that certain data on the platform can be outdated or not updated as frequently as required, impacting decision-making accuracy.
  • Focus on Urban Areas
    The website is more beneficial for users interested in urban properties, as rural areas may have less comprehensive data coverage.

Codictionary features and specs

  • Centralized Code Knowledge
    Codictionary provides a centralized platform for storing and organizing coding terminology, definitions, and snippets, making it easier for developers to find and reference information in one place.
  • Collaborative Learning
    The platform supports collaborative contributions, allowing developers to share knowledge, add definitions, and help build a community-driven coding dictionary that benefits everyone.
  • Beginner-Friendly
    Codictionary is designed to be accessible to newcomers in programming, offering clear and simple explanations of coding terms and concepts that can help beginners get up to speed quickly.
  • Free to Use
    The platform is available for free, making it an accessible resource for developers at all levels without requiring a subscription or payment to access coding definitions and knowledge.
  • Clean and Simple Interface
    Codictionary features a straightforward and easy-to-navigate user interface, allowing users to quickly search for and find the coding terms and definitions they need without unnecessary complexity.

Possible disadvantages of Codictionary

  • Limited Content Depth
    As a relatively niche platform, Codictionary may not have the breadth or depth of content found on more established resources like Stack Overflow, MDN, or official documentation sites.
  • Small Community
    The platform has a smaller user base compared to major developer communities, which means fewer contributions, slower updates, and potentially less peer review of content accuracy.
  • Limited Advanced Topics
    The platform may focus more on basic definitions and terminology, potentially lacking in-depth coverage of advanced programming concepts, design patterns, or complex technical topics.
  • Potential for Outdated Information
    With a smaller community maintaining content, some entries may become outdated as programming languages and technologies evolve, without timely updates to reflect current best practices.
  • Less Recognized Platform
    Being a lesser-known tool in the developer ecosystem, Codictionary may not be widely recognized or trusted as an authoritative source compared to well-established documentation and reference sites.
